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45653394 8195 48665721
7776615 78229671896 60192318
7776615 78229671896 60192318
42 47080838 2776
All about undefined
Interested in learning more?
7776615 78229671896 60192318
42 47080838 2776
See more
4872 380129 1602350728
9238062990 431245010 56128756615
See more
4345748391 3825704 9887355618
8777208746 376599 959844588
See more